"Colgate" stems from a joke in the fandom because Minny's mane and tail look a lot like toothpaste. "Colgate" is possibly the most known brand, and "Colgate" is a real name, so it stuck. When she was shown to wear a doctor's robe in Luna Eclipsed, it really stuck.
